What is the difference between Full Time Cement Plant Manager vs Cement Production Supervisor?

AspectFull Time Cement Plant ManagerCement Production Supervisor
ResponsibilitiesOversees entire plant operations, strategic planning, and management of staffSupervises daily production activities, ensures safety and quality standards
CredentialsBachelor's degree in engineering or related field, management experienceTechnical diploma or degree, experience in cement production
Work EnvironmentOffice-based with plant site visitsOn-site supervision in the production area
Industry UsageSenior management role in cement manufacturingOperational role focused on production processes

The Full Time Cement Plant Manager holds a broader leadership role overseeing the entire plant, while the Cement Production Supervisor focuses on daily production activities. Both roles require relevant technical credentials and experience, but the manager's responsibilities are more strategic and managerial, whereas the supervisor's are more operational and hands-on.

What does a full time cement plant manager do?

A Full Time Cement Plant Manager oversees the daily operations of a cement manufacturing facility. Their responsibilities include managing staff, ensuring safety and environmental compliance, optimizing production processes, and maintaining equipment. They also handle budgeting, coordinate with suppliers and customers, and implement strategies to improve efficiency and product quality. The role requires strong leadership, technical knowledge of cement production, and the ability to solve operational challenges. Effective communication with team members and upper management is also essential.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a full time cement plant manager, and why are they important?

To excel as a Full Time Cement Plant Manager, you need a solid background in engineering or industrial management, extensive knowledge of cement production processes, and several years of relevant supervisory experience. Familiarity with plant management software, maintenance systems, and safety regulations is typically required, along with certifications such as OSHA or PMP being advantageous. Strong leadership,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for managing diverse teams and responding to operational challenges. These competencies ensure efficient production, regulatory compliance, and a safe, productive work environment.

What are some common challenges faced by a full time cement plant manager and how can they be addressed?

A Full Time Cement Plant Manager often faces challenges such as maintaining high production efficiency while ensuring strict safety and environmental compliance. Balancing operational costs with equipment maintenance and workforce management is also key. Effective managers address these challenges by fostering a culture of continuous improvement, investing in staff training, and implementing proactive maintenance schedules. Regular communication and collaboration with engineering, logistics, and quality assurance teams help in identifying issues early and driving operational success.

Job description

Line of Business: Cement & White

About Us
Heidelberg Materials is one of the world's largest suppliers of building materials. Heidelberg Materials North America operates over 450 locations across the U.S. and Canada with approximately 9,000 employees.
What You'll Be Doing
  • Oversee daily production operations to ensure efficiency and quality.
  • Implement and maintain safety protocols and procedures.
  • Train and mentor production staff to enhance performance.
  • Monitor and manage inventory levels and supply chain logistics.
  • Collaborate with other departments to optimize production processes.
What Are We Looking For
  • Prior cement plant or heavy industrial experience.
  • Strong leadership and team management skills.
  • Excellent problem-solving and decision-making abilities.
  • Effective communication and interpersonal skills.
  • Proficiency in production management software and tools.
  • Preferred: Ability to obtain ATF clearance to operate specialized materialโ€‘clearing equipment (e.g., kiln guns or similar equipment) used in cement plant operations.
Work Environment
  • Fast-paced manufacturing setting.
  • 12-hour rotating shifts: 4 days on, 4 days off
  • Requires standing, walking, and lifting up to 50 pounds.
  • Exposure to varying temperatures and noise levels.
What We Offer
  • Competitive base salary ($77,180 - $102,900) and participation in our annual incentive plan.
  • 401(k) retirement savings plan with an automatic company contribution as well as matching contributions.
  • Highly competitive benefits programs, including:
    • Medical, Dental, and Vision along with Prescription Drug Benefits.
    • Health Savings Account (HSA), Health Reimbursement Account (HRA), and Flexible Spending Account (FSA).
    • AD&D, Short- and Long-Term Disability Coverage as well as Basic Life Insurance.
    • Paid Bonding Leave, 15 days of Paid Vacation, 40 hours of Paid Sick Leave, and Paid Holidays.
